Fallen leaves may contain molds or fungi and often a lot of insect debris and other organic material and these can cause allergic reactions.  It would be wise for you to avoid any close contact with fallen leaves (raking and/or bagging).  If that is the cause it should subside spontaneously, with avoidance.

It is also possible that you do have a sinus infection (bacterial or fungal) and would benefit from treatment.  I understand your reluctance to add to your medical bills but you will probably need further medical evaluation and that could include sinus X-rays or a CT Scan or culture of the drainage.  You might want to investigate to see if there is  a reasonably priced clinic for persons without health insurance coverage in your area, as these do exist in many cities.
